+/* Define these variables that serve as global parameters to termcap,
+ so that we do not need to conditionalize the places in Emacs
+ that set them. */
+
+char *UP, *BC, PC;
+short ospeed;
+
+static buffer[512];
+
+/* Interface to curses/terminfo library.
+ Turns out that all of the terminfo-level routines look
+ like their termcap counterparts except for tparm, which replaces
+ tgoto. Not only is the calling sequence different, but the string
+ format is different too.
+*/
+
+char *
+tparam (string, outstring, len, arg1, arg2, arg3, arg4, arg5, arg6, arg7, arg8, arg9)
+ char *string;
+ char *outstring;
+ int arg1, arg2, arg3, arg4, arg5, arg6, arg7, arg8, arg9;
+{
+ char *temp;
+ extern char *tparm();
+
+ temp = tparm (string, arg1, arg2, arg3, arg4, arg5, arg6, arg7, arg8, arg9);
+ if (outstring == 0)
+ outstring = ((char *) (malloc ((strlen (temp)) + 1)));
+ strcpy (outstring, temp);
+ return outstring;
+}
